What time can I visit Húcares Beach, and is it easy to get there?

Húcares Beach is a public beach, so it is open 24 hours a day, every day of the week, although visiting during daylight hours is the most advisable for safety and visibility. It is located in Naguabo, Puerto Rico, and can be easily reached by car. Parking is available nearby, although it may be limited on very busy days.

Do I have to pay to enter Húcares Beach, or is it free?

Good news! Entry to Húcares Beach is completely free. It is a public beach and there are no admission fees. However, keep in mind that some nearby services, such as private parking or equipment rentals, may have associated costs.

How much time is recommended at Húcares Beach to enjoy it properly?

To fully enjoy Húcares Beach, I recommend setting aside at least half a day, around 3 to 4 hours. This will give you enough time to relax on the sand, swim, take a walk along the shore, and perhaps enjoy a picnic. If you plan to do water activities or explore thoroughly, you could stay the whole day.

Does Húcares Beach have any special history or significance?

Although Húcares Beach is not linked to major well-known historical events, it stands out as a place of great natural beauty and tranquility, representing the essence of Caribbean beaches. It is a gathering place for the local community and a refuge for visitors seeking peace and contact with nature, reflecting Puerto Rico's rich coastal biodiversity.

What is the best time to visit Húcares Beach to avoid crowds and enjoy the weather?

The best time to visit Húcares Beach is during the dry season, from December to April, when the weather is cooler and there is less chance of rain. To avoid crowds, I suggest going on weekdays early in the morning or late in the afternoon. Weekends and holidays are usually busier.

Is Húcares Beach suitable for people with reduced mobility or wheelchairs?

Access directly onto the sand at Húcares Beach can be challenging for people with reduced mobility, as there are no specific walkways or ramps for wheelchairs. The beach has natural sand, which can make movement difficult. It is advisable to check the availability of accessible facilities at nearby businesses before your visit.

What other interesting things are there to visit near Húcares Beach?

Near Húcares Beach, you can explore the Naguabo Boardwalk, ideal for a stroll and for trying fresh seafood at local restaurants. El Yunque National Forest is also within a reasonable distance, perfect for hiking and nature. Any practical tips to make the most of my visit to Húcares Beach?

For the best experience, I recommend bringing your own snacks, drinks, and plenty of sunscreen, as there are not many services directly on the beach. Dress comfortably, bring towels, and if you plan to swim, consider water shoes. It is essential to respect the natural environment, take all your trash with you, and keep the beach clean for everyone.
